Kestevan, Reseller Programme. Branch managers, this summarises the state of the Meridian Partner Scheme at handover. Tier criteria were revised last quarter; eleven resellers now hold Gold status, and margin rebates are reconciled monthly by the Falworth office. Outstanding items: two pending accreditation audits and the disputed territory split between the Northvale and Drassington branches. Daniela assumes ownership of all partner escalations from Monday. Please note the confidential planning guidance appended directly below this note.

management briefing: Jorixax Holdings is in early talks to buy Casixax Holdings for about $420.3 million. The Fenmir launch date is October 27, and nothing goes to the press before then. Legal wants the Keloxek Foods term sheet redrafted before April 16.

Subject: Brindlekit cut-over — done!

Hi all,

The shared component library is now on strict semantic versioning as of this morning's cut-over. Plugin authors should pin to a major range instead of exact versions; patch releases will no longer break you (we promise, and CI now enforces it). Legacy tags stay resolvable until next quarter. The registry is serving the new scheme with these settings.

service settings:
[casax]
port = 6379
team = rusir
host = casax.zemvarhq.corp
region = outer-4
access_code = ac_9808ce
timeout_ms = 1500

// Crash-report pipeline constants (Pebblewing ingest tier).
// Reports arrive from the Lanternfall mobile SDK in gzipped batches;
// we debounce duplicate stack hashes before forwarding to triage.
// Reviewers: the retry window must stay shorter than the SDK's
// client-side resend interval or we double-count crashes. Queue
// depth caps were sized against the worst spike we saw during the
// Marrowgate launch. Do not raise batch size without re-running the
// dedupe soak test. The tuning constants are defined immediately below.

constants for kawef-bawif:
TIERS = {
    "oliir": 236,
    "lamion": 438,
    "pelmir": 279,
}